Resthave Home Ice Cream Social June 16

Come join us for Resthave Home’s Annual Ice Cream Social, on Thursday, June 16, 2016.  From 5:30 to 7:00 p.m., share in the socialization, baked goods, fun, entertainment, and food!  The location is 408 Maple Avenue, Morrison, IL. The cost is a monetary donation.

Fillies Fall in Extra Inning

Morrison Fillies’ Lauren Pannier limited the Sterling, IL, Golden Warriors to one hit and one run through five innings, Saturday, May 14, 2016, at the Elmhurst, IL, Tourney.  She held a 5-1 lead going into the sixth inning.

Fillies Ground Rockets

The Morrison Fillies used the long ball to subdue the Burlington Central Rockets on Saturday, May 14, 2016, at the Elmhurs, IL, Tourney.  Emma Sitzmore went deep for a 3-run homer in the fourth inning.  Jaeden Workman did the same for a 2-run shot in the sixth inning.

Fillies Top Chicago Christian

Both teams splattered ten hits at the Elmhurst, IL, Tourney, on Saturday, May 14, 2016.  The Morrison Fillies turned their hits into ten runs.  Their opponent from Chicago Christian could only cross the plate four times.
